SAN JOSE, Calif. -- The board of the Semiconductor Industry Association (SIA) elected John Daane, president, chief executive, and chairman of the board of Altera Corp., as its 2010 chairman.
Ray Stata, chairman of the board of Analog Devices Incorporated, was elected vice chairman.
Hector Ruiz, who resigned as chairman of Globalfoundries Inc. earlier this week after being reportedly linked to a high-profile insider-trading case, will not speak as planned at the SIA awards dinner on Thursday (Nov. 5), according to a spokesperson for the SIA.
The SIA spokesperson confirmed Wednesday that Ruiz has bowed out of the event, but did not provide further details. Ruiz, who remain's SIA's 2009 chairman until the organization's annual meeting Thursday, had been scheduled to give a talk titled "Chairman's Reflections" at the dinner in San Jose, Calif.
Separately, John E. Kelly III, senior vice president and director of Research at IBM, has been named 2009 winner of the semiconductor industry's highest honor, the Robert N. Noyce Award. The award is presented by the SIA to recognize outstanding contributions to the microelectronics industry.
